Google Accounts For 57.5 Percent Of All Reviews Across The World
Google is in the lead here, followed by Facebook as a remote second.
These the online reviews circulation rankings:
Google with 57.5%, Facebook at 19%, TripAdvisor at 8.4%, Yelp with 6.6% and Others at 8.6%.
Source: Review Trackers
US Buyers Regard "Product Performance" To Be The Most Helpful Detail In Product Reviews
When individuals check out reviews, they concentrate on different aspects of the shopping experience. However according to online review stats, 60% of them are most thinking about the item's performance.
Client satisfaction, product quality and quality with time are the next couple of factors to consider for more than 50% of American consumers.
Source: Statista
